Output 203578ddbfa272935155592a2efc957307c4ade6aa386dc603d81b0c182541d9:14

value
221590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c727e543d0c83fc9c1dfb4cc868bcb8bbbf45047 OP_EQUAL
address
3Kr4BiAUu7aSfJzE7o9EQmqdyiy8mmcZZ6
transaction
203578ddbfa272935155592a2efc957307c4ade6aa386dc603d81b0c182541d9
spent
true